REPLACE SPARK PLUG
Replace the spark plug each year to ensure
the engine starts easier and runs better. Set
spark plug gap at 0.025 inch (0.6 mm). Igni-
tion timing is fixed and nonadjustable.
1. T wist, then pull off spark plug boot.
2. Remove spark plug from cylinder and
discard.
3. Replace with Champion RCJ-6Y spark
plug and tighten securely with a 3/4 inch
(19 mm) socket wrench.
4. Reinstall the spark plug boot.

REPLACING THE LINE
1. Remove spool by firmly pulling on tap
button.
2. Clean entire surface of hub and spool.
3. Replace with a pre-woun d spool, or cut two
lengt hsof
12-1/2
feet ( 3.8meters) of 0 .080
!
(2 mm) diameter Pou lan PRO
r
brand line.
W ARNING:
Never use wire, rope,
string,etc., whichcanbreakoffandbecomea
dangerous missile.
4. Insert e nds of the lines a bout 1/2 inch (1
cm) into the small h oles on th e inside of
spool.

5. Wind the line evenly and tightly onto the
spool. Wind in the direction of the ar rows
found on the spool.
6. Push the l ines into thenotches, leaving 3
to 5 inches (7 -- 12 cm) unwound.
7. Insert the lines into the the exit holes in
the hub as shown in the illustration.
8. Align the notches with the line exit holes.
9. Push spool into hub until it snaps into
place.
10. Pull thelines extendingoutsideof thehub
to release the lines from the notches.

CARBURETOR ADJUSTMENT
W ARNING:
Keep others away when
making idle spee d adjustments. Th e trimmer
head, blade or an y optional attachment will be
spinn ing during most of this proced ure. Wear
your protective e quipment and observe all safe-
ty precautions. After making adjustments, the
trimmer head, blade or any optional attachment
must not move/spin at idle speed.
The carburetor has been carefully set at the
factory.Adjustments maybenecessaryif you
notice any of the following conditions:
S
Engine will not idle when the throttle is
relea se d.
S
The trimmer head, blade or optional
attachment moves/spins at idle.
Make adjustments with the unit supportedso
the cutting attachment is off the ground and
will not make contact with any object. Hold
theunit b yhandwhile runningandmakingad-
justments. Keep all parts of your body away
from the cutting attachment and muffler.
Idle Speed Adjustment
Allow enginetoidle. A djustspeed untilengine
runs without trimmer head, blade or optional
attachment moving or spinning (idle too fast)
or stalling (idle speed too slow).
S
Turn idle speed screw clockwise to
increase engine speed if engine stalls or
dies.
S
Turn idle speed screw counterclockwise to
decrease engine speed if trimmer head,
blade or optional attachment moves or
spins at idle.
W ARNING:
Recheck the idle speed
after each adjustment. The trimmer head,
blade or optional attachment must not move
or spin at idle speed to avoid serious injury to
the operator or others.
